Mathematics is the 32nd most popular major in the country with 31,080 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, mathematics gra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$44,066 and had an average of $21,378 in loans still to pay off.
Across Missouri, there were 451 mathematics gra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,500 and $17,866 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 18 mathematics graduates with average earnings and debt of $73,755 and $111,628 respectively.

Out of the 3 schools in the Best Value Math Schools for a Doctorate in Missouri that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Missouri - Columbia landed the #1 spot on the list. This large school is located in Columbia, Missouri, and it awarded 5 doctorate’s math degrees in 2019-2020.
Mizzou did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#2 on our “Best Mathematics Doctor’s Degree Schools in Missouri”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at University of Missouri - Columbia are $27,193, but some majors have different tuition rates.

Out of the 3 schools in the Best Value Math Schools for a Doctorate in Missouri that were part of this year’s ranking, Missouri University of Science and Technology landed the #2 spot on the list. This medium-sized school is located in Rolla, Missouri, and it awarded 6 doctorate’s math degrees in 2019-2020.
In addition to being on our missouri doctor’s degree math students list, Missouri University of Science and Technology has also earned the #3 rank in our “Best Mathematics Doctor’s Degree Schools in Missouri” ranking.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at Missouri University of Science and Technology are $30,943.

Out of the 3 schools in the Best Value Math Schools for a Doctorate in Missouri that were part of this year’s ranking, Washington University in St Louis landed the #3 spot on the list. This fairly large school is located in Saint Louis, Missouri, and it awarded 5 doctorate’s math degrees in 2019-2020.
As a testament to the quality of education offered at WUSTL, the school also landed the #1 spot in our “Best Mathematics Doctor’s Degree Schools in Missouri” ranking.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at Washington University in St Louis are $56,562.
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Saint Louis University. The school came in at #3 for the Best Value Math Schools for a Doctorate in Missouri. SLU is a fairly large private not-for-profit school situated in Saint Louis, Missouri. It awarded 2 doctorate’s math degrees in 2019-2020.
SLU not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#4 on our “Best Mathematics Doctor’s Degree Schools in Missouri”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at Saint Louis University are $22,074, but some majors have different tuition rates.
